Mumbai Indians set a target of 169 for victory in their first match in the Indian Premier League. Kell Rahul’s century gave Lucknow a decent score. Mumbai got off to a great start as they chased down the winning target.

Ishant Kishan took the first wicket in the eighth over to put Mumbai on 49. Ravi Bishno’s first ball came out. And the outsiders are in a very unfortunate way.

Ishan Kishan, who hit a shot on a googly by Ravi Bishnoi, hit the ball in Decock’s boot. The ball bounced up and the holder caught it. The wicketkeeper – batsman started walking towards the dressing room before half appeal, but the umpire ruled him out after a review.

He scored 8 off 20 balls. Ishaan has been going through very bad form this season. He has scored 199 runs in 8 matches this season
